Elements Influencing Cat Flap Installation Costs
Numerous essential factors can affect the total costs associated with installing a cat flap:
Type of Cat Flap: The option in between handbook and electronic cat flaps can significantly impact the price.
Material of the Door: Installation expenses differ depending upon whether the door is wooden, PVC, or glass.
Installation Location: Different places, such as exterior walls or glass doors, may require additional materials or labor.
Associated Labor Costs: The hourly rate of a professional or handyman can vary based on location and proficiency, which influences the overall installation cost.
Extra Features: Advanced features like microchip compatibility can increase the price of both the cat flap and the installation.
Cost Breakdown
Here's a breakdown of potential expenses related to cat flap installation:
| Cost Component | Approximated Cost |
|---|---|
| Cat Flap Unit | ₤ 50 - ₤ 300 |
| Labor Costs | ₤ 100 - ₤ 200 |
| Products for Installation | ₤ 20 - ₤ 50 |
| Overall Estimated Cost | ₤ 170 - ₤ 550 |
1. Cat Flap Unit
Cat flaps range in price depending on their type:
- Manual Cat Flaps: Basic models, generally made from plastic, begin at around ₤ 50.
- Electronic/Smart Cat Flaps: Offer functions like microchip compatibility and are priced between ₤ 150 and ₤ 300.
2. Labor Costs
Professional installation is frequently a good idea to ensure appropriate fitting. Labor costs can range in between ₤ 100 and ₤ 200, depending upon the intricacy of the installation.
3. Materials for Installation
The additional materials needed for installation normally cost between ₤ 20 and ₤ 50. This could consist of screws, insulation strips, and cutting tools.
Types of Cat Flaps
When choosing a cat flap, numerous types are readily available, each with distinct features:
- Standard Cat Flaps: Functional and straightforward, designed for simple gain access to.
- Electronic Cat Flaps: Allow access only to cats with particular microchips, keeping out strays or other animals.
- Magnetic Cat Flaps: Use a collar magnet that allows just the cat wearing the magnet to enter.
- App-Controlled Cat Flaps: Advanced models that can be controlled through applications on smartphones.
Pros and Cons of Each Type
| Type |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|
| Basic Cat Flaps | Affordable, simple to install. | Less protected. |
| Electronic Cat Flaps | Improved security, selective gain access to. | Greater cost, battery replacements. |
| Magnetic Cat Flaps | Basic innovation, effective. | Can malfunction sometimes. |
| App-Controlled Cat Flaps | Modern functions, remote gain access to. | Pricey, tech problems. |
F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TION
How do I pick the ideal cat flap for my home?
Picking the best cat flap depends on your needs. Consider your cat's habits, the number of animals you have, and whether you have concerns about unwanted animals entering your home.
Can I set up a cat flap myself?
While DIY installation is possible, it's recommended to seek professional help, particularly for complex setups involving walls or glass doors.
Are there particular regulations for pet doors?
Depending on where you live, there might be policies or standards, particularly concerning security and safety. Constantly examine local regulations before installation.
For how long does the installation process take?
Usually, the installation of a cat flap can take anywhere from 1 to 3 hours, depending on the intricacy of the work involved.
Will installing a cat flap impact my home's insulation?
An appropriately installed cat flap ought to not adversely affect your home's insulation. However, bad installation may lower energy effectiveness, so professional installation is advisable.
